Construction Engineering Technology is above average in terms of popularity with it being the #183 most popular degree program in the country. This means you won't have too much trouble finding schools that offer the degree.
College Factual reviewed 11 schools in Texas to determine which ones were the best for degree seekers in the field of construction engineering technology. When you put them all together, these colleges and universities awarded 1,217 degrees in construction engineering technology during the 2020-2021 academic year.

Texas A&M University - College Station is a wonderful option for students interested in a degree in construction engineering technology. Located in the midsize city of College Station, Texas A&M College Station is a public university with a very large student population. A Best Colleges rank of #44 out of 2,217 schools nationwide means Texas A&M College Station is a great university overall.
There were approximately 315 construction engineering technology students who graduated with this degree at Texas A&M College Station in the most recent data year.
